@charset 'utf-8';
/* Eric Meyer's Reset CSS v2.0 - http://cssreset.com */
html,body,div,span,applet,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td,article,aside,canvas,details,embed,figure,figcaption,footer,header,hgroup,menu,nav,output,ruby,section,summary,time,mark,audio,video{border:0;font-size:100%;font:inherit;vertical-align:baseline;margin:0;padding:0}article,aside,details,figcaption,figure,footer,header,hgroup,menu,nav,section{display:block}body{line-height:1}ol,ul{list-style:none}blockquote,q{quotes:none}blockquote:before,blockquote:after,q:before,q:after{content:none}table{border-collapse:collapse;border-spacing:0}
i,em {
    font-style: italic;
}
body {
    background: url(../images/format/bg.png);
    color: #888;
    font-family:'Lucida Grande', 'Hiragino Kaku Gothic ProN', 'ヒラギノ角ゴ ProN W3', Meiryo, メイリオ, sans-serif;
    font-size: 14px;
}
a {
    color: #666;
    text-decoration: none;
    font-weight: normal;
}
a:hover {
    text-decoration: underline;
}
#wrapper {
    margin: 0 auto;
    width: 1000px;
}
#header {
    overflow: hidden;
    padding:20px 25px 40px;
}
#globalNav {
    float:left;
    overflow: hidden;
}
#sns {
    float: right;
    overflow: hidden;
}
#globalNav .item {
    float:left;
}
#globalNav .item a {
    background: url(../images/format/globalNav.png) no-repeat;
    display: block;
    height: 0;
    overflow: hidden;
}
#globalNav .logo a {
    width:64px;
    margin-right: 25px;
    padding-top: 64px;
}
#globalNav .home a,
#globalNav .info a,
#globalNav .projects a,
#globalNav .exhibitions a,
#globalNav .note a,
#globalNav .contact a
{
    margin-right: 40px;
    margin-top: 9px;
    padding-top: 37px;
}
#globalNav .home a {
    width: 58px;
    background-position: -90px 0;
}
#globalNav .info a {
    width: 48px;
    background-position: -193px 0;
}
#globalNav .projects a {
    width: 99px;
    background-position: -420px 0;
}
#globalNav .exhibitions a {
    width: 122px;
    background-position: -565px 0;
}
#globalNav .note a {
    width: 53px;
    background-position: -725px 0;
}
#globalNav .contact a {
    width: 89px;
    background-position: -290px 0;
}
#globalNav .home a:hover                {background-position: -90px  -44px;}
#globalNav .home.selected a:hover       {background-position: -90px  0;}
#globalNav .info a:hover,
.info #globalNav .info a                {background-position: -193px -44px;}
#globalNav .projects a:hover,
.projects #globalNav .projects a        {background-position: -420px -44px;}
#globalNav .exhibitions a:hover,
.exhibitions #globalNav .exhibitions a  {background-position: -565px -44px;}
#globalNav .note a:hover,
.note #globalNav .note a                {background-position: -725px -44px;}
#globalNav .contact a:hover,
.contact #globalNav .contact a          {background-position: -290px -44px;}

#sns .item {
    float: left;
}
#sns .item a {
    background: url(../images/format/globalNav.png) no-repeat;
    display: block;
    height: 0;
    margin-left: 15px;
    margin-top: 12px;
    padding-top: 32px;
    width:32px;
}
#sns .fb a       {background-position: -871px 0;}
#sns .tw a       {background-position: -918px 0;}
#sns .in a       {background-position: -965px 0;}
#sns .fb a:hover {background-position: -871px -34px;}
#sns .tw a:hover {background-position: -918px -34px;}
#sns .in a:hover {background-position: -965px -34px;}

.pagination {
    clear:both;
    padding:20px 0;
    position:relative;
    font-size:15px;
    line-height:20px;
    overflow: hidden;
}

.pagination span,
.pagination a {
    display:block;
    float:left;
    margin: 2px 8px 2px 0;
    padding:6px 12px 5px;
    text-decoration:none;
    width:auto;
    color:#fff;
    background: #888;
}

.pagination a:hover{
    color:#fff;
    background: #3279BB;
}

.pagination .current{
    padding:6px 12px 5px;
    background: #3279BB;
    color:#fff;
}
#footer {
    border-top: 1px solid #ebebeb;
    font-size: 12px;
    margin: 70px auto 0;
    padding: 20px 0 60px;
    text-align: center;
    width: 320px;
}
